About Anna Gunn

Anna Gunn plays Skyler White in Breaking Bad. She gives the domestic side of the story the same seriousness as its criminal business. A careful question, a pause or a look at Walter can make a scene uncomfortable without raising the volume.

Gunn grew up in Santa Fe and studied theatre at Northwestern University. Her screen career includes Jean Ward in The Practice and Martha Bullock in Deadwood. Martha's controlled manner offers a different kind of performance from Skyler's more immediate domestic pressures, but both depend on Gunn making thought visible without explaining it aloud.

Breaking Bad brought her two supporting-actress drama Emmys. The role asks her to play somebody responding to another person's increasingly difficult behaviour while retaining a life and point of view of her own. Her scenes opposite Bryan Cranston work because neither actor treats the conversation as merely a pause between larger events.

After the series, she starred opposite David Tennant in Gracepoint, playing detective Ellie Miller. Her film work includes the financial drama Equity, in which she plays investment banker Naomi Bishop, and The Apology. Gunn is particularly convincing when a character is trying to maintain composure while deciding how much of what she thinks can safely be said.
